Manassas, Virginia Confederate fortifications

 

Here for your browsing pleasure is an extraordinary photo of Manassas, Virginia; Confederate fortifications, with Federal soldiers. It was made in 1862 by Barnard, George N., 1819-1902.

The photo documents the main eastern theater of war, Confederate winter quarters, 1861-1862.
